I took a closer look at the skin vs the pixie screenshots you mentioned. I agree the screenshot is small, but the shading on key areas like the bottom of the sternum, ribcage area and ab area don't match up and are less flat than what is presented on the sims skins. The pecs are not as tight as the pixie skin. Areas like the eyebrows, lips, under the nose and nose tip also don't match up. If the skin is a rip, i don't think the textures themselves are coming from the Pixie skins.

However, the skins have similar tones in that the underlying shading is greenish, which Enayla uses often in her illustrations (typically a ruby red, a deep jadish green, or a dark blue).

I do find the skin overall to be rather blurry and there are a few key areas where it's highly probable that the skin maker did not have a properly calibrated screen. Of course, it's also highly probable that the source texture was low rez... or both.
